Court of Appeals, State of Michigan ORDER People of MI v Hayden Kenneth Jagst Kirsten Frank Kelly Presiding Judge Docket No. 368256 Thomas C. Cameron LC No. 2021-027050-FC Noah P. Hood Judges The application for leave to appeal is DENIED for lack of merit in the grounds presented. Having reviewed the challenged sentence in light of the principles set forth in People v Posey, ___ Mich ___; ___ NW2d ___ (2023) (Supreme Court Docket No. 162373), and People v Posey (On Remand), ___ Mich App ___; ___ NW2d ___ (2023) (Docket No. 345491), we conclude that it was proportionate to the seriousness of the circumstances surrounding the offense and the offender. _______________________________ Presiding Judge Hood, J., would grant the application for leave to appeal.
